This internship supports our Project Manager in the development, planning, execution, and management of projects across the company. The intern will gain hands-on experience in both office and plant settings while contributing to initiatives that improve manufacturing processes and support long-term growth. Requirements

  • Rising junior or senior pursuing a deg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Electrical, Chemical, or Industrial preferred).
  • Ability to define problems, gather and analyze data, and draw sound conclusions.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office; CAD or similar technical software is a plus.
  • Strong verbal, written, and presentation skills.
  • Comfortable working in both office and plant environments; compliance with all safety procedures is required.
  • Interest in fostering a workplace culture of mutual respect, belonging, and open expression.
  • Manufacturing experience preferred but not required.
  • Ability to travel 25%.

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with technicians and plant staff to understand and identify process improvement opportunities.
  • Coordinate activities with contractors, technicians, and internal stakeholders.
  • Collect, analyze, and utilize operational data to propose and implement improvements.
  • Assist in managing projects from concept and capital scoping through implementation and commissioning.
  • Create and update technical documents, P&ID diagrams, process flowcharts, and standard reports.
  • Evaluate vendor proposals and make recommendations based on technical and economic criteria.
  • Support the design of layouts that optimize space, materials, equipment, and personnel movement.
  • Work with cross-functional teams including engineering, safety, operations, and automation to ensure project success.
